Detalles del Curso

โ€ข Introduction to Quantum Cryptography: Basics of quantum mechanics, classical cryptography, and the need for quantum cryptography.
โ€ข Quantum Key Distribution (QKD): Quantum superposition, quantum entanglement, BB84 protocol, and security analysis.
โ€ข Quantum-Resistant Cryptographic Algorithms: Lattice-based cryptography, code-based cryptography, and hash-based cryptography.
โ€ข Quantum Computing and Cryptography: Basics of quantum computing, Shor's algorithm, Grover's algorithm, and their impact on cryptography.
โ€ข Post-Quantum Cryptography Standards: NIST PQC competition, current status, and potential winners.
โ€ข Quantum Random Number Generation: True randomness, quantum randomness, and applications in cryptography.
โ€ข Quantum Cryptographic Protocols: E91, B92, SARG04, and other protocols for quantum key distribution.
โ€ข Practical Quantum Cryptography: Experimental implementations, real-world applications, and challenges.
โ€ข Quantum Cryptography Hardware: Quantum key distributors, single-photon detectors, and other related hardware.
โ€ข Security and Privacy in Quantum Networks: Quantum key management, secure communication, and privacy issues.
